Accor accelerates its digital strategy by taking over FASTBOOKING

Accor announces the take-over of FASTBOOKING, a digital services provider for the hotel industry. A French company founded in 2000, FASTBOOKING provides daily support to nearly 4,000 hotels worldwide. Its key areas of expertise are hotel website development, distribution channel management solutions, digital marketing campaign management, revenue management optimization tools and competitive intelligence. Its two main markets are Europe and Asia.

FASTBOOKING will continue to deliver innovative solutions designed to improve the performance and visibility of its clients, while operating independently within Accor. The confidentiality of data relating to FASTBOOKING’s client hotels will be fully preserved. At the same time, the expertise of FASTBOOKING’s teams will broaden the range of services
that Accor can offer to its hotels.

“The take-over of FASTBOOKING will help speed up the implementation of our digital strategy,” said Sebastien Bazin,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Accor. “Following the acquisition of Wipolo last October, this new transaction enables us to further expand our capabilities and strengthen our digital expertise for the benefit of our hotels.

While maintaining its independence, FASTBOOKING will now enjoy the support of a global leader capable of providing the resources it needs to make the most of its enormous potential, so that it can continue to innovate for an even larger client base.”
